What is Companion Planting?

Companion planting is a centuries-old technique where different plants are grown together to enhance growth, health, and productivity. This method takes advantage of the unique characteristics and properties of various plant species to create a mutually beneficial environment. When plants grow together, they can share nutrients, provide shade, or release chemicals that repel pests, making it an ideal approach for gardeners who want to boost their potato yields.

For example, planting marigolds with potatoes can help deter nematodes and other pests that target tuber crops. Nasturtiums, on the other hand, can repel aphids and whiteflies, reducing the risk of infestations. By combining different plants in a single bed, gardeners can create a diverse ecosystem that promotes healthy growth and minimizes the need for pesticides.

This approach also helps to improve soil fertility by incorporating nitrogen-fixing legumes into the mix. Beans and peas are excellent examples of companion plants that can provide essential nutrients to potatoes without depleting the soil’s resources. By adopting companion planting, gardeners can enjoy a more sustainable and productive potato crop while reducing their reliance on chemical fertilizers and pest control measures.

Nitrogen-Fixing Legumes as Companions

Legumes like beans, peas, and clover are natural nitrogen-fixers that can complement potatoes by enhancing soil fertility. These plants have nodules on their roots where bacteria convert atmospheric nitrogen into a form usable by plants. As potatoes grow alongside legumes, the latter’s nitrogen fixation process benefits the entire crop. This reduces the need for synthetic fertilizers, saving gardeners money and minimizing environmental impact.

To integrate legume companions effectively, consider planting beans or peas near potato crops, as they have similar growing requirements. Clover, being more hardy, can thrive in poorer soil conditions, making it a suitable option for areas with challenging growing conditions.

Some popular nitrogen-fixing legumes that pair well with potatoes include:

  • Bush beans: These compact varieties don’t compete with potatoes for space and can be planted densely.
  • Garden peas: They prefer cooler temperatures and moist soil, which complements potato growth.
  • White clover: Its spreading habit helps fill gaps between rows, reducing weed competition.

By incorporating these legume companions into your potato crop, you’ll not only improve soil fertility but also promote a healthier ecosystem.

Repellent Plants that Keep Pests Away

Basil is a natural repellent for aphids and other pests, and its fragrance can also improve potato flavor. Plant basil near your potatoes to keep these unwanted visitors at bay. Another herb with pest-repelling properties is mint. Its strong scent deters aphids, spider mites, and even nematodes. However, be cautious when using mint as a companion plant, as it can spread aggressively.

Lemongrass is also an effective repellent for pests like Colorado potato beetles and wireworms. This tropical grass releases a citrusy oil that repels these insects and keeps them from feeding on your potatoes. To get the most out of lemongrass as a companion plant, plant it around the perimeter of your potato bed to create a barrier.

These repellent plants not only help protect your potatoes from pests but also attract beneficial insects like bees and butterflies. Planting a mix of herbs like basil, mint, and lemongrass near your potatoes can create a balanced ecosystem that promotes healthy growth and reduces pest problems.

Managing Aphids with Nasturtiums and Marigolds

Nasturtiums and marigolds are two potent allies in managing aphid populations on potatoes. These flowers repel aphids through a combination of their strong scent and taste, which deters these pests from feeding on nearby potato plants.

Nasturtiums release a chemical called trimethylamine into the air, which is unappealing to aphids. Planting nasturtiums alongside your potatoes creates a barrier that keeps aphids away. Sow nasturtium seeds around the base of your potato plants, and allow them to spread out as they grow.

Marigolds also repel aphids with their strong scent. These flowers contain a chemical called pyrethrum, which is toxic to aphids. Planting marigold flowers near your potatoes not only keeps aphids away but also attracts beneficial insects that prey on these pests.

When using nasturtiums and marigolds for aphid control, be sure to plant them in close proximity to your potato plants. Aim for at least 3-5 nasturtium or marigold plants per square meter of potato bed. This will ensure a strong presence of the flowers’ repelling chemicals and maximize their effectiveness against aphids.

By incorporating these two companion plants into your potato garden, you can significantly reduce aphid populations and promote healthier growth for your potatoes.

Using Chives to Repel Aphids and Other Pests

Chives are a natural pest repellent that can be used to protect potatoes from aphids and other unwanted insects. When grown alongside potatoes, chives release chemicals into the air that deter aphids, whiteflies, and spider mites. These pests often target potato plants because of their high water content and nutrient-rich soil.

In addition to repelling aphids, chives can also help control nematodes, microscopic worms that feed on potato roots. By planting chives near your potatoes, you can create a barrier against these pests. Chives are easy to grow and require minimal maintenance, making them an ideal companion plant for home gardens.

To get the most out of this beneficial relationship, plant chives around the perimeter of your potato patch or intersperse them among the rows. This will allow their repelling properties to spread evenly throughout the area. Keep in mind that while chives are effective at repelling pests, they may not eliminate the problem entirely. Regular monitoring and other companion planting strategies can provide additional protection for your potatoes.

How Comfrey Improves Soil Fertility

Comfrey acts as a fertilizer plant, adding nutrients to the soil that benefit potato growth. It’s a perennial herb with deep taproots that allow it to access nutrients other plants can’t reach. As comfrey grows, its roots break down and release these nutrients into the surrounding soil.

This process is called “nutrient cycling,” where comfrey acts as a “green manure” plant, feeding the soil with essential micronutrients like nitrogen, phosphorus, and potassium. These nutrients are then absorbed by nearby plants, including potatoes, promoting healthy growth and development.

To use comfrey effectively in your garden, consider the following tips:

  • Plant comfrey around the perimeter of your potato bed to maximize its benefits.
  • Chop or dig up comfrey leaves regularly to release their nutrient-rich sap into the soil.
  • Comfrey’s deep taproots can grow up to 3 feet deep, so be mindful not to overwater and damage them.

By incorporating comfrey into your companion planting strategy, you’ll be creating a more self-sustaining ecosystem that benefits both the plants and the soil.

Protecting Potatoes from Heat Stress with Sunchokes

In warm climates, heat stress can severely impact potato growth and yield. Sunchokes (Helianthus tuberosus) can be a valuable companion plant for potatoes in these conditions. By growing sunchokes alongside your potatoes, you can create a shaded microclimate that helps regulate soil temperature.

Sunchokes are known to produce dense foliage that provides effective shade, keeping the soil cooler by up to 5°C (9°F). This is particularly beneficial during periods of high heat stress, when temperatures often reach above 30°C (86°F) in warm climates. By cooling the soil, sunchokes reduce moisture loss from the potato plants, which helps conserve water and maintain healthy growth.

To use sunchokes effectively as a companion plant for potatoes, consider planting them around the perimeter of your potato bed. This will allow them to grow up towards the sun while still providing shade for the surrounding area. Sunchokes are relatively easy to establish and require minimal maintenance, making them an attractive option for gardeners looking to mitigate heat stress in their potato crops.

Some benefits of using sunchokes as a companion plant include:

  • Improved soil health through increased organic matter production
  • Enhanced biodiversity by attracting beneficial pollinators and other insects
  • Reduced soil erosion due to the extensive root system of sunchokes

Tips for Successful Companion Planting

When implementing companion planting strategies in your potato garden, it’s essential to consider a few key factors. First and foremost, choose companion plants that complement the growth habits of your potatoes. For example, tall plants like sunflowers or corn can provide shade for young potato plants, preventing scorching from intense sunlight.

To ensure successful companion planting, also pay attention to spacing. Plant companions close enough to allow them to interact with each other, but not so close that they compete for resources. A general rule of thumb is to plant companions within a 3-6 inch radius around your potato plants.

Another crucial aspect of companion planting is choosing the right mix of repellent and beneficial plants. For example, planting marigolds alongside potatoes can help deter nematodes, while basil repels aphids and other pests that target potatoes. Consider planting at least three to five different companions in each bed to create a balanced ecosystem.

When selecting companions, also consider their growth habits and maturity dates. Plant fast-growing companions like nasturtiums or chives early in the season to provide an initial barrier against pests, while slower-growing plants like comfrey or borage can be added later as they mature.

To manage pests naturally with companion planting, focus on using repellent plants that release chemicals into the soil or air that deter pests. For instance, garlic and onions repel aphids, whiteflies, and other pests, making them excellent companions for potatoes. By carefully choosing and spacing companion plants, you can create a thriving ecosystem that promotes healthy growth and reduces pest issues in your potato garden.
